Document Transport — Safe Lock Replacement

Heads-up for the warehouse shift lead: the replacement lock mechanism for the records safe at the Brindlehall office ships with the Thursday pouch run. It's in a small padded case marked FRAGILE, and it stays sealed until the locksmith from Quorra Secure opens it on site. Don't stack anything on it, and don't leave it unattended on the dock. The courier hand-over line that applies is below:

handover note for yagef-bagep: the drudor pelius courier leaves the kasdor zorvan norir ledger at gate 8016 under passcode 755406

## Bike Cage & Parking Gates — Harlowfen Yard

Quick one for the facilities desk: the bike cage behind Building 3 and both parking gates run off the same Pondrell controller, so if one's down, check the panel first before logging separate faults. Gates auto-open 07:00–09:30 on weekdays. For manual overrides out of hours, swipe at the reader and enter the code below.

door code, kawip-bagap: bdg-HQEWH-4

## Authentication

The Duskpanel admin dashboard requires authentication before theme preferences, including dark mode, can be persisted. Theme state is stored server-side in the Palette service, so unauthenticated sessions fall back to system default and changes are silently dropped. Reviewers should verify that all theme writes pass through the authenticated Palette client rather than local storage. The Palette service key used by the review environment appears below.

app token of kajop-tahag = qvz23-qaEp6MzrfP2AwhVbZwsZeUq